9-6-1: PERMIT REQUIRED:
No person shall move any building on, through or over any street, alley, sidewalk, or other public place in the city without having obtained a permit therefor from the City Council. Applications for such permits shall be made, in writing, to the Clerk and shall state thereon the proposed route and the number of days it is intended that the building shall occupy any portion of any street, alley, sidewalk or other public place. Before issuance of any special permit for the above uses, the City Council shall refer the proposed application to the City Planning and Zoning Commission 1
, which Planning and Zoning Commission shall be given thirty (30) days in which to make a report regarding the effect of such proposed building or use upon the character of the neighborhood, traffic conditions, public utility facilities and other matters pertaining to the public health, public safety and general welfare. No action shall be taken upon any application for a proposed building or use above referred to until and unless the report of the City Planning and Zoning Commission has been filed; provided, however, that if no report is received from the City Planning and Zoning Commission within sixty (60) days of the date of the public hearing, it shall be assumed that approval of the application has been given by the said Planning and Zoning Commission.
